## Releases

Graphvane ships tagged releases monthly. Plugin authors targeting the visualizer API should pin to the latest minor version and verify downloaded archives before bundling. Every release artifact is signed by the Graphvane maintainers, and verification is mandatory for plugins distributed through the Tessel registry. You can verify archives against the public signing key shown below.

signing key of bagap-yawep = bky13_TbfT6ZMUoGJo2

// Loyalty-points ledger grace window (Tindlemart rewards).
// Points "pending" for this many hours before they post, so refunds
// can claw them back without a compensating ledger entry. Shortening
// this breaks the nightly reconciler — it assumes pending rows older
// than the window are safe to finalize. If reconciliation drifts,
// don't touch this constant first; check the reconciler's cursor.
// Any incident writeup should cite the ledger build token shown below.

pipeline stamp: htk3_69f

Welcome, contractors. The leaked-file-descriptor investigation on the Cinderpath ingest workers requires approval before any diagnostic change ships. This includes adding lsof-style instrumentation, raising ulimits, or attaching tracers to production processes. Submit a short plan describing the hypothesis, blast radius, and rollback step. Approvals are turned around within one business day; emergency leaks get a faster path via the incident channel. All requests must be signed off by the investigation lead, named below.

approver of yajef-fajef = Oliwyn Silion Kasok Kasox